Jones, Leon – 1979
More than 5,000 books, articles and legal cases are summarized in this annotated bibliography on school desegregation, covering the years 1954-1974. The reference section is divided into three subsections: one for books and monographs; one for articles (including scholarly journals, popular magazines, pamphlets, case studies, selected newspaper…

Congressional Digest, 1974
Reviews the foundations of present Federal policy on school busing to achieve desegregation and summariezes judicial trends of the 1960's and Congressional actions since 1964. (Author/SF)
